EDUC 360: Literacy Issues and Methods I
3.00 Credits
Antioch University-Seattle
FA In this overview of critical issues in reading and writing, students learn theories and practices of teaching reading, writing and communication skills. The course considers the full spectrum in the field of literacy, from whole language to direct instruction methods and theories. Particular emphasis is given to beginning reading development and reading as the construction of meaning.

EDUC 370: Critical Issues in Native American Education
3.00 Credits
Antioch University-Seattle
Educational issues in Native American communities - from birth through adulthood - are addressed, with particular attention to the Pacific Northwest region. Emphasis is on solutions for current educational issues and how to involve families and communities with schools and other educational institutions.

EDUC 430: Teaching the Arts
3.00 Credits
Antioch University-Seattle
SP Integrate creative arts (music, visual arts, drama and creative movement/dance) into planning academic, technological and multicultural curricula for K-8 classrooms. Students are introduced to the basic elements, principles, related concepts and vocabulary of the creative arts, and learn to apply district and state (EALR) guidelines for the creative arts curriculum. The course expands exposure to and appreciation of creative arts methods that can be applied to specific classroom instruction.

EDUC 450: Math Methods for K-8 Teachers
3.00 Credits
Antioch University-Seattle
Students learn theories and a variety of approaches to teaching math. The coursework emphasizes number sense, patterns and algebraic sense, geometry and measurement, and probability and statistics. Using manipulatives, students explore problem solving, reasoning, communication and connections.

EDUC 452: Teaching Life Science With Lab
3.00 Credits
Antioch University-Seattle
SP The great Northwestern natural environment is the laboratory for students in this class. During field trips to Puget Sound, mountains and forests, students learn about the flora and fauna, and the development and processes that create the Northwestern ecosystem.
